    Return of the Jedi parallels "The Phantom Menace" and "Revenge of the Sith" most strongly.
    The Phantom Menace parallels "Revenge of the Sith", "A New Hope", and "Return of the Jedi".

    This will sound odd to someone who hasn't watched the movies repeatedly, but it became apparent to me (a while ago actually) that the saga starts green and ends green. TPM and ROTJ have the most scenes set in a green environment.
    The only green setting in Revenge of the Sith is Kashyyk, and that turns fittingly grey after most of the Wookies are wiped out.

    I think the endings to the movies are cool. The episodes in each trilogy each have similar endings...

    I & IV both have celebrations

    II & V have 2 people and 2 droids looking out pondering the future

    III & VI have people gazing off (Kind of a stretch, I know)
